*A cut and paste from Rosedale's Insulin paper.....
Insulin sensitivity is going to start being determined from the moment the
sperm combines with the egg. If your mother, while you were in the womb was
eating a high carbohydrate diet, which is turning into sugar, we have been
able to show that the fetus in animals becomes more insulin resistant.

Worse yet, they are able to use sophisticated measurements, and if that
fetus happens to be a female, they find that the eggs of that fetus are more
insulin resistant.
